Handover note — Crumbwheel order cutoffs.

Welcome aboard. The bakery cutoff rule in Crumbwheel closes same-day orders at 14:00 local to each storefront, not UTC — this has bitten us twice. Holiday overrides live in the calendar service and take precedence silently, so always check there first when a cutoff looks wrong. To unlock the calendar service's admin console after a restart, enter the recovery passphrase below.

vault phrase of bagap-bahaf = silion-pelox-sorox-casdor-quenwyn-fraax-eliox-praael-kelion-quenvan-kasox-rusael-norius-belvan

## Break-Glass Access: SpokeShift Rebalancer

SpokeShift decides which vans move bikes between docks overnight. Normally you never touch prod — reviews happen on staging snapshots. But if the planner deadlocks and vans are idling, break-glass access lets you restart the solver directly. Keep it rare and log everything. The emergency console accepts the recovery passphrase written just below.

unlock words, kawig-bawef: belax-sorir-druax-ulaiel-wenael-belael

## Further Reading

The thumbnail generation queue (Shrinkray) consumes uploads from the Coppervault bucket, renders in an isolated worker pool, and writes results back under a separate service identity. For review purposes, the relevant materials are the worker sandbox profile, the queue ACL matrix, and the image-parser fuzzing report from last quarter. Input validation happens before enqueue; workers never see raw user metadata. The threat model and data-flow diagrams are maintained on the internal page below.

wiki page, tahaf-tajog: https://jira.ordindyn.corp/pipeline

Meeting notes — Tuesday, admin sync. The signed score sheets from the Varnholt Regional Chess Final are boxed and sealed in the front office. Arbiter Delva confirmed all 64 sheets are accounted for. The federation office in Kestlebridge wants originals, not scans, by Friday. The courier arrangement is noted below for your reference only.

courier memo of yawep-yafog: the pramir ulaix courier leaves the ulavan aldix frair zorok oliiel joreth rusdor fenvan ledger at gate 1305 under passcode 514738